What is copper metal sheet?
The conductor Instantly recognisable by its unique, orangey hue, copper sheet is a distinctive, malleable metal that’s up to hundreds of jobs. One of the basic chemical elements (CU in case you’ve forgotten your Periodic Table), it’s been popular for millennia. Our copper sheet plate comes in a range of thicknesses and we can cut it to size, supplying you with just the amount you need. Traditionally, copper’s long list of pluses have made it a firm favourite in industry and construction: after all, it’s soft, brilliant at conducting heat and electricity, resistant to corrosion, and even has antibacterial properties. More recently, though, the metal has come into high demand by architects and interior designers simply because it looks great. Whether you’re looking for form of function, there are limitless uses for copper sheet. UK based, we supply sheet metal to clients all over the country. When you buy copper sheet from us, there’s no minimum order. Just select the amount you need from the box above, or call us to take advantage of our free cutting service. How is it made? Copper ore is mined from deep underground, then taken away to be cleaned, crushed and milled. It then undergoes several chemical processes and put into an electro-refining tank for purification, before it is eventually melted down and cast into ingots, rods, or cakes. To make copper sheet, these chunks of copper are then rolled out flat. Benefits- Malleable

What is Bright Galvanised Steel Sheet?
Robust, reliable and rust-resistant, our bright galvanised steel sheet is just the job when weather-proofing is a must. With its tough coating of zinc carbonate, it’s designed to withstand the most extreme of the elements and last for a very long time. From walls to washing machines, the scope for our best-selling metal is endless. We know that everyone’s need for galvanised steel plate is different, which is why we’re happy to cut yours down to the exact size you need. This free service ensures you have exactly what you need for your project, with absolutely nothing going to waste. Plus, there’s no minimum order, meaning no job’s too small.
Good for: Car parts, roofs, inner and outer wall sheeting, sheds, construction parts, buckets, planters, wheelbarrows, drainpipes, tubes, sections, machine-building, domestic appliances, electrical goods, agricultural machinery and many more. Galvanised steel’s properties make it tough enough for most exterior projects.
Painting: Galvanised steel looks great when it’s coated in colour, but always use specialist primer and paint.
How it’s made: Galvanised sheet steel is made when sheet steel is passed through a bath of red-hot, molten zinc. When oxygen reacts with pure zinc, zinc oxide is formed. Zinc oxide reacts with carbon dioxide to form zinc carbonate. It might be dull and grey, but what it lacks in lustre, zinc carbonate more than makes up for in performance. Like an excellent outdoor jacket, zinc carbonate is what protects the steel within from the weather, and the reason why galvanised steel sheets are a proven favourite in the great outdoors. Galvanised steel used to be easily recognisable by its trademark star or spangle pattern, formed on the metal’s surface during the treatment process. As smoother surfaces became more popular, spangles shrunk and, in the case of our steel sheet, they are not visible to the naked eye. Our Bright Galv is very shiny

Pickled and Oiled Hot Rolled Steel Sheets
The smoother steel
Rolling, pickling and oiling might all sound like they’re something to do with food, but before you get hungry, remember that this is a metal website and in this case we’re talking about steel (sorry!) When metal goes through any hot process, it can be left with a residue or scaling on its surface, which, when exposed to moisture, can turn to rust. This can be avoided by giving the steel a treatment to which smoothes things over, called pickling. Afterwards, the material is rinsed before a protective layer of oil blocks out the elements and gives this metal its flawless looks and strong performance. It’s perfect if your project requires a metal with a totally blemish-free surface: think painting, powder-coating and furnishings. As with all our products, hot rolled pickled and oiled steel sheet (also known as oiled steel sheet and pickled steel sheet) can be trimmed to the precise size you need, with no minimum order. Our hot rolled steel prices are highly competitive; just select what you need in the boxes above, or call us to take advantage of our free cutting service.
Good for: Radiators, metal furniture, domestic appliances, powder-coating, painting ...this oiled steel is perfect for any other situation in which a smooth surface is paramount.
How it’s made:
The process of making hot rolled steel leads to oxidisation, meaning a layer of scale, impurities and debris can be left behind. In order to prevent rust from forming on the surface of the metal when it is exposed to the air, this scale needs to go. Pickling takes care of this: by dipping the steel sheet into exactly the right acid, the oxide is dissolved and the metal is de-scaled. The ‘scale jacket’ that’s removed is a very thin layer, usually a tiny fraction of a centimetre thick, but it makes all the difference to the finished product’s appearance: metal with scale has a grey, dull appearance, whereas that which has been pickled comes out with a gleaming sheen. Once the scale is gone, pickled steel is rinsed, before being given an extra layer of protection from the elements in the form of an oil barrier.
